Brazilian President Luiz Inácio Lula da Silva in Stable Condition After Emergency Surgery

Brazilian President Luiz Inácio Lula da Silva is recovering in stable condition following emergency surgery for an intracranial hemorrhage related to a fall. Doctors confirmed that he regained consciousness and is expected to leave the hospital next week. Vice President Geraldo Alckmin has assumed Lula’s responsibilities temporarily. Lula has faced health challenges in the past, including a recent hip replacement and previous throat cancer treatment, but remains optimistic about his future political role.
